
Victorian, dated 1852. 14.75ins by 12.25ins wide. 1852 Sampler by Margaret Jenkison. Framed in an old wood frame with rippled, old glass.
Tacked to a wood stretcher frame with wood and brown paper backing.
The sampler is worked in a silk-like thread on canvas ground, in a variety of stitches including Algerian eye.
Meandering floral border.
Colours greens, cream, browns, gold and blue. Alphabets A-V in upper case.
Verse reads
'God is a Spirit and they that worship him must worship him
in spirit and in truth. John IV. Ver. 24 G.H.S. H.S.Y.'
Signed and dated
'Margaret Jenkison. 1852.'
A good set of motifs, including fruit trees,
flowers,
potted flowering plants,
rabbits,
fruit baskets,
fir trees,
crowns,
birds
and dogs.
